package org.metafacture.flux;

import org.metafacture.flux.parser.FlowBuilder;
import org.metafacture.flux.parser.FluxLexer;
import org.metafacture.flux.parser.FluxParser;
import org.metafacture.flux.parser.FluxProgramm;

import org.antlr.runtime.ANTLRInputStream;
import org.antlr.runtime.CommonTokenStream;
import org.antlr.runtime.RecognitionException;
import org.antlr.runtime.tree.CommonTreeNodeStream;

import java.io.IOException;
import java.io.InputStream;
import java.util.Map;

/**
 * Creates a flow based on a flux script.
 *
 * @author Markus Michael Geipel
 */
public final class FluxCompiler {
    private FluxCompiler() {
        // no instances
    }

    /**
     * Compiles the flux to a flow.
     *
     * @see FluxProgramm
     * @param flux the flux
     * @param vars the variables of the flux
     * @return the flow
     * @throws RecognitionException if an ANTLR exception occurs
     * @throws IOException          if an I/O error occurs
     */
    public static FluxProgramm compile(final InputStream flux, final Map vars) throws RecognitionException, IOException {
        return compileFlow(compileAst(flux), vars);
    }

    private static CommonTreeNodeStream compileAst(final InputStream flowDef) throws IOException, RecognitionException {
        final FluxParser parser = new FluxParser(new CommonTokenStream(new FluxLexer(new ANTLRInputStream(flowDef))));
        return new CommonTreeNodeStream(parser.flux().getTree());
    }

    private static FluxProgramm compileFlow(final CommonTreeNodeStream treeNodes, final Map vars)
            throws RecognitionException {
        final FlowBuilder flowBuilder = new FlowBuilder(treeNodes);
        flowBuilder.addVaribleAssignements(vars);
        return flowBuilder.flux();
    }
}
